Dame Louise Joyce Ellman DBE (née Rosenberg; born 14 November 1945) is a British politician who served as Member of Parliament (MP) for Liverpool Riverside
Mark Ellman (died February 26, 2023) was a Hawaii-based restaurant chef. His first Hawaiian restaurant, Avalon, is on Maui; he became its owner in 1991
Ellman's was an American catalog merchant. Founded in 1946 in Atlanta, Georgia as a jewelry store, it began operating catalog stores in 1966. The chain
Michael John Ellman (born 1942, United Kingdom) has been a professor of economics at the University of Amsterdam since 1978. He is now an emeritus professor
John Ellman (17 October 1753 – 22 November 1832) was an English farmer and stock breeder who developed the Southdown breed of sheep. John Ellman was born
Ellman's reagent (5,5′-dithiobis-(2-nitrobenzoic acid) or DTNB) is a colorogenic chemical used to quantify the number or concentration of thiol groups
Laura Ellman is a Democratic member of the Illinois Senate for the 21st district. The district, located in the Chicago metropolitan area includes all or
Ben Ellman is an American saxophonist, harmonica player, and producer most widely known as a member of the New Orleans–based funk band Galactic, with whom
